Why Process Mapping is Fundamental to a Successful Business.

In today's fast-paced and competitive business environment, process mapping has become an essential tool for organisations striving for success. Process mapping involves visually representing the steps, actions, and flow of activities within a business process. It provides a clear and detailed overview of how tasks are performed, highlighting areas for improvement and enhancing overall efficiency. Here are a few reasons why process mapping is fundamental to a successful business.


Firstly, process mapping helps identify bottlenecks and inefficiencies within a workflow. By visually mapping out each step, businesses can easily pinpoint areas where tasks are delayed, duplicated, or prone to errors. This knowledge allows for targeted improvements, streamlining processes, reducing waste, and ultimately saving time and resources.


Secondly, process mapping promotes transparency and collaboration. When team members have a clear understanding of their roles and how they fit into the bigger picture, it fosters better communication and collaboration. Employees can identify dependencies, handoffs, and potential areas of conflict, enabling them to work together more effectively and align their efforts toward achieving common goals.



Thirdly, process mapping enables continuous improvement. Once a process is mapped, it becomes easier to measure and analyse its performance. Key performance indicators (KPIs) can be established, and data can be collected to evaluate the effectiveness and efficiency of the process. This data-driven approach empowers businesses to identify areas for improvement, implement changes, and measure the impact of those changes, leading to continuous optimisation and enhanced productivity.


Lastly, process mapping enhances customer satisfacti


on. By understanding the customer journey and mapping out the processes that impact customer experience, businesses can identify pain points and areas where customer satisfaction may be compromised. With this insight, they can make informed decisions to streamline and improve customer-facing processes, ensuring a smooth and enjoyable experience for their clients.


In conclusion, process mapping is a fundamental tool for any successful business. It enables organisations to identify inefficiencies, promote collaboration, drive continuous improvement, and enhance customer satisfaction.


By investing time and resources into process mapping, businesses can lay a solid foundation for growth, efficiency, and long-term success.
